In older times and in developing countries earthquakes would frequently knock over wood and coal-burning stoves. In modern communities fires can start when earthquakes rupture gas lines.

Q: What causes fires to ignite after an earthquake?

Can putting out wildfires sometime lead to more severe fires?

Yes. If man prevents small fires from happening over a number of years, the volume of underbrush (fuel for fires) builds up and when it eventually does ignite, the ensuing fire is far worse.
